Web30 de mar. de 2024 · ethanol, also called ethyl alcohol, grain alcohol, or alcohol, a member of a class of organic compounds that are given the general name alcohols; its molecular formula is C2H5OH. Ethanol is an important industrial chemical; it is used as a solvent, in the synthesis of other organic chemicals, and as an additive to automotive gasoline … WebSolimini (2005) reported an underestimation of dry mass for mayies in ethanol of approximately the same magnitude. The strain of ethanol known … origins spot creamWebDensity of ethanol at various temperatures [ edit] Data obtained from Lange 1967 These data correlate as ρ [g/cm 3] = −8.461834 × 10 −4 T [°C] + 0.8063372 with an R2 = 0.99999.
